The Fame Monster was a massive commercial success. In its first week in the United States, the individual disc of the EP charted at number five on the Billboard 200 with sales of 174,000 copies. The deluxe edition, which included the original The Fame , also performed strongly, moving up to number six with 151,000 copies. According to Billboard, the EP has sold 1,585,000 copies in the U.S. as of March 2014. Worldwide, the EP was the best-selling album of 2010, moving 5.8 million units.

The Fame Monster , released in November 2009, was not just an album; it was a cultural shift. Originally conceived as a deluxe reissue of her debut album The Fame , it evolved into a standalone masterpiece containing eight tracks that defined the sonic landscape of the new decade.
